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ander communities — how many people identify as First Nations, and how they fare on age, schooling, work, income and language. From the ABS 2021 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Peoples Profile; the ABS notes these counts are an undercount.
More people identify as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ander in Allworth than in about 73% of similar areas. The First Nations community here is notably older than the state and national averages, with a typical age of 35 years.

How many people identify as First Nations, and the typical age.
There are 26 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people in the area. At a typical age of 35, they are far older than the national figure of 24.

Personal and household incomes.
The usual personal income for First Nations people is $725, which is well above the Australian figure of $540. However, household income is much lower than most areas at $1,124, falling well below the New South Wales figure.

Use of an Australian Indigenous language at home.
No one in the community speaks a First Nations language. This is far below the national figure of 12.3% and well below the state figure of 4.0%.
